Position Overview

We are seeking a dedicated and proactive Surgical Waiting List Administrator to join our administrative team within the Hepatobiliary Department at University Hospitals Birmingham NHS Foundation Trust. This role is essential in managing surgical waiting lists and ensuring efficient patient flow.

Key Responsibilities

  • Oversee the administration of inpatient waiting lists, ensuring precision and meticulous attention to detail.
  • Continuously monitor and validate the waiting list for liver surgeries, including both minor and major cancer procedures, striving to meet established Key Performance Indicators.
  • Participate in cancer Patient Tracking List (PTL) meetings, coordinating with cancer services to update surgical dates and proactively manage breach dates.
  • Attend theatre utilization meetings to ensure the theatre schedule is current, facilitating timely patient bookings for surgery and optimizing theatre resources in collaboration with consultants.

Essential Skills and Qualifications

  • Strong general education, including GCSEs in English and Maths.
  • Business Administration NVQ Level 3 or equivalent experience in an administrative capacity.
  • Proven experience in customer service and public interaction.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el, Outlook) and familiarity with IT systems.
